An Overview of Crime Rates in Dothan, AL

Crime can be categorized into two primary types: violent and property crimes. Violent crimes encompass offenses such as murder, rape, robbery, and assault, whereas property crimes involve acts like burglary, theft, and vehicle theft. The overall crime rate in Dothan is 73.6% higher than the national average. Specifically, there were 651 violent crimes reported in Dothan, equivalent to 913 per 100,000 residents, which is higher than the national average by 154.2%. Additionally, Dothan recorded 1972 property crimes, amounting to 2765 per 100,000 people, higher than the national average by 57.1%.

Potential Causes for Crime in Dothan

Dothan has a poverty rate that stands at 18, in contrast to the national average of 15.1. Historically, a direct correlation has been observed between poverty rates and crime stats. Higher poverty rates have led to higher crime rates, while lower poverty rates have led to a reduction in Dothan crime rates. Income disparities and heightened poverty levels can serve as catalysts for elevated or reduced criminal activity, as individuals may or may not turn to illicit means to fulfill their basic needs. This could be one of many factors that may influence crime.

Regions characterized by high population density frequently encompass expansive urban hubs that offer diverse economic prospects. In such areas, income inequality can be exacerbated, creating pockets of poverty alongside affluence. Economic disparities within these regions may correlate with elevated property crimes and, in certain instances, violent crimes. Conversely, areas with low population density numbers generally exhibit reduced Dothan crime rates. Dothan registers a population density of 791.8 people per square mile, in contrast to the national average of 90.6 people per square mile.

        Chance of Being A Victim of Crime in Dothan

        The chance of being a victim of violent crime in Dothan is 1 in 110
        The chance of being a victim of property crime in Dothan is 1 in 37
        The chance of being a victim of crime in Dothan is 1 in 28
        Are you at risk of becoming a victim of crime in Dothan, Alabama? If you reside in Dothan, then there is a 1 in 110 chance that you will experience a violent crime. These types of crimes may include homicide, sexual assault, robbery, and physical assault. Your risk of being a victim of property crime is 1 in 37. These types of crime include burglary, petty theft, and theft of motor vehicles. Altogether, there is a 1 in 28 risk that you will become a victim of crime in Dothan.

        Source: The Dothan, AL crime data displayed above is derived from the FBI's uniform crime reports for the year of 2024. The crime report encompasses more than 18,000 city and state law enforcement agencies reporting data on property and violent crimes. The uniform crime reports program represents approximately 309 million American residents, which results in 98% coverage of metropolitan statistical areas.
